The auto-reel is used for winding power supply cable, control cable and hydraulic hose of mobile unit like a hoist crane, carriage on wheel or a shield machine. The auto-reel is winds cables, hoses, and wires by power of springs or a motor automatically. Today's technology allows the supervision and control of an entire distribution system from a single controller, referred to as an automatic transfer switch (ATS) or automatic changeover unit (ACU). The distribution board is a panel that houses the fuses, circuit breakers, and ground leakage protection units used to distribute electrical power to numerous individual circuits or consumer points.
